<TABLE WIDTH="90%" CELLSPACING=0 CELLPADDING=0 ALIGN=CENTER><TR><TD>Quote, originally posted by petty$rep &raquo;</TD></TR><TR><TD CLASS="quote">Ive got a question about the original post.

If he were to install a good cam on the D series, about how much whp gain would he be looking at?

Not trying to thread jack</TD></TR></TABLE>

3....maybe? Without a sufficient build on the engine an aftermarket IM, cam, and adjustable cam gear will only net you about 5-10whp or so on a good tune. Not good for what you're paying for in my opinion.

Anyways.

At OP:

Skunk2 has been having trouble with some of their intake manifolds reducing hp by not flowing enough. Call skunk2 and see if they have a recall out for yours. In the meanwhile what you can do is put the regular one on to gain back the blocked off hp. As far as the adjustable cam gear goes, nothing really noticable, you could put a more aggressive cam on their such as the D15b cam which will net you more hp but it's still a slight difference...like the difference a cold air intake (short bore) would make.

My advice:
Leave it alone until you figure out what you're going to do with the manifold. Then work from there. If it's part of the recall, send it back, if not, buy another one or something... Either way I'd buy an edelbrock if the one w/ skunk2 doesn't work out ...but make sure your IM is good before putting a more aggressive cam and ajustable cam gear in there...then get it tuned.

Won't be much, but it'll be nice if you drive only D-series, you'll feel more power...but you won't be running down mustangs.
